Autozero settings
Autozero setting
Description
OFF
Turns automatic reference measurements off.
ONCE
After immediately taking one reference and one zero
measurement, turns automatic reference measurements off.
AUTO
Automatically takes new acquisitions when the 2606B determines
reference and zero values are out-of-date.

Remote command autozero
To set autozero from a remote interface:
Use the autozero command with the appropriate option shown in the following table to set autozero
through a remote interface (see
(on page 7-192)). For example, send the
following command to activate channel A automatic reference measurements:
smua.measure.autozero = smua.AUTOZERO_AUTO
Autozero command and options
Command
Description
smu
X
.measure.autozero = smu
X
.AUTOZERO_OFF
Disable autozero. Old NPLC cache values are
used when autozero is disabled (see
(on page 2-39)).
smu
X
.measure.autozero = smu
X
.AUTOZERO_ONCE
After immediately taking one reference and one
zero measurement, turns automatic reference
measurements off.
smu
X
.measure.autozero = smu
X
.AUTOZERO_AUTO
Automatically takes new acquisitions when the
2606B determines reference and zero values are
out-of-date.
